CLI 是 Claude Code 的核心入口,但话说回来,大多数开发者日常仍沉浸在 IDE 中。VS Code、Cursor、JetBrains 等主流编辑器均能无缝对接 Claude Code,让 AI 直接与当前文件、选中代码甚至整个项目结构进行交互。
本文同时梳理了 VS Code 和 JetBrains 两条接入路线,适合已安装好 CLI、希望将 Claude Code 融入日常编辑环境的开发者。

VS Code 安装 Claude Code
前提是 CLI 本身必须能正常运行,先确认版本:
claude --version
接着打开 VS Code 或 Cursor,在扩展商店搜索 Claude Code 相关插件,安装即可。

安装完成后,打开项目目录,后续操作其实非常直观。

使用聊天输入框
插件通常会提供一个聊天输入框,你可以直接下达任务:
- 解释当前文件的核心逻辑
- 为选中的函数补充单元测试

@ 提及文件和文件夹
VS Code 中一个非常实用的功能是通过 @ 直接引用文件或目录:
@src/auth/login.ts 解释这个文件的登录流程
@src/components 帮我总结这些组件的职责

Claude 会结合被引用的上下文给出响应,这样你就不必再手动复制粘贴代码,显著提升效率。
编辑和 diff
当 Claude 提供修改建议时,IDE 会直接展示变更内容。仔细查看 diff,再决定是否接受,这是最稳妥的实践。

如果拿不准,完全可以继续追问:
解释你为什么这样修改
只保留第一处修改,撤回其他变更
恢复过去对话
任务进行到一半被打断是常有的事。没问题,历史会话随时可以恢复,继续之前的进度。




JetBrains 支持的 IDE
JetBrains 系列覆盖广泛,IntelliJ IDEA、WebStorm、PyCharm、GoLand、PhpStorm 等主流 IDE 均在其支持范围内。

核心功能与 VS Code 路线大同小异:
- 从 IDE 终端启动 Claude Code
- 读取当前项目上下文
- 与 IDE diff 工具协同工作
- 支持远程开发及 WSL 场景
JetBrains 安装步骤
第一步,确认 CLI 可正常使用:
claude --version
第二步,在 JetBrains 插件商店搜索 Claude Code 插件并完成安装。

第三步,从 IDE 内置终端启动:
claude

如果你习惯使用外部终端,也可以在 Claude Code 中输入:
/ide

Diff 工具和插件设置
建议优先配置 IDE 自带的 diff 功能,这样在接受或拒绝修改时会更直观高效。

插件的设置面板中可以调整快捷键、显示方式以及各项集成细节,满足个性化需求。

远程开发和 WSL
如果你在 WSL2 或远程开发环境中使用,请记住关键一点:确保 Claude Code 从项目根目录启动,并且 IDE 能够访问到同一套文件系统。

常见问题
Q: 插件安装后没有功能?
A: 请先确认 CLI 本身可用,然后重启 IDE 重试。
Q: 提示 No available IDEs detected?
A: 从 IDE 内置终端启动,或在外部终端执行 /ide 命令即可解决。
